Although Waterbeach train station is unstaffed, it offers a range of facilities to ensure a smooth and hassle-free journey. Travelers can utilize ticket machines for purchasing tickets and collecting those bought online. The station accommodates passengers with mobility challenges, although step-free access is only partially available. Assistance can be pre-booked, and help points are stationed on the platforms around the clock.
While the station lacks a fully-equipped ticket office, the available machines are designed for accessibility and offer discounts with the Disabled Persons Railcard. For those looking to catch some rest before their train, unheated waiting shelters are available. Remember, there's ample parking with 82 spaces and four accessible spots, ensuring you can leave your vehicle behind with peace of mind.
Being well-connected is vital for any train station, and Waterbeach excels in that department. Although it doesn’t offer local bus information directly, the 'Onward Travel Information Map' provides guidance for continued low-stress transit. In instances of rail service disruptions, a rail replacement service may be offered. For further travel flexibility, it’s helpful to know that there are no cycle hire facilities, though cyclists can safely store their bikes with ample stands available.

Sheffield Station boasts a wide range of amenities to make your journey comfortable. The station offers ticket offices with extensive opening hours—Monday to Saturday from 05:00 to 22:50 and on Sundays from 07:45 to 23:00. Ticket machines are readily available for quick and easy purchases, and online tickets can be collected on-site with ease. For those using smartcards, validators and issuance are accessible, enhancing the efficiency of travel.
The station is designed with accessibility in mind. With step-free access across all areas, tactile paving, and available ramps for train access, travel is made convenient for passengers with mobility impairments. Sheffield Station also offers accessible tickets machines and toilets, plus convenient seating areas. While there aren't accessible taxis directly at the station, there is an impaired mobility set down/pick-up point, assuring safe and straightforward transit to and from the station.
For continued travel, Sheffield Station is connected to a variety of public transport services. Rail replacement buses operate from bus stands E5 and E6, and a taxi rank is located right at the station front. Additionally, the station connects seamlessly with Sheffield's 'Stagecoach Supertram,' which stops conveniently beside the station, providing an easy transfer to various parts of the city. For journeys further afield, TransPennine Express offers frequent direct services to Manchester Airport.
